EL SEGUNDO, Calif., Aug. 30 /PRNewswire/ -- Computer Sciences Corporation today announced that Foresters(TM) -- a Toronto-based financial services organization operating in the U.S., Canada and the U.K. -- has implemented CSC's nbAccelerator (nbA) software to automate its life insurance and annuity new business and underwriting activities. This marks the first use of nbA for life insurance policies. By streamlining its processes through the integration of nbA with CSC's VANTAGE-ONE insurance administration software, Foresters anticipates significant improvements in productivity and reduced unit costs.
CSC's nbA, which is based on ACORD standards, automates life insurance and annuity application submission, requirements management, underwriting management, workflow and productivity reporting, and policy issue processing. By eliminating processing steps, reducing handoffs and automating tasks, nbA increases productivity and decreases the administrative costs of life and annuity contracts.
The Foresters launch of nbA is part of a larger program to reduce administration costs; enhance integration with internal and external providers; and improve the speed, efficiency and quality of its services. Foresters chose nbA for its easy integration with other CSC software, its compatibility with the company's existing major design and architectural requirements, and the opportunity to join with other nbA users in guiding enhancements to the software.
"Integrating a new business system into our back office is a key component in the Foresters foundation for future growth," said Gail Johnson Morris, Foresters senior vice president, Service Delivery. "nbAccelerator will allow us to reduce insurance administration costs and provide enhanced services to our members and distribution channels."
"During the 25 years we've worked together, Foresters has achieved impressive business results leveraging CSC's experience," said Michael W. Risley, president of the Life & Annuity Division of CSC's Financial Services Group. "Being the first to implement nbAccelerator for life insurance is another of this company's innovative yet practical business strategies."
Other insurers already use CSC's nbA to process annuities, but Foresters is the first production use of nbA for life policies. Foresters will use nbA to issue and underwrite term, whole life and universal life individual insurance as well as annuities.
About Foresters
Founded in 1874, Foresters(TM) helps individuals and families achieve financial security with its innovative portfolio of life insurance products and annuities. Foresters has assets of more than $4.6 billion with liabilities of $3.6 billion resulting in a surplus of $1 billion (all figures in U.S. dollars) and an "A" (Excellent) rating by A.M. Best*. Foresters shares its financial strength with its members, who are customers, through complimentary life, health and education benefits that help its 850,000 eligible members and their families in the United States, Canada and the United Kingdom. Foresters provides opportunities that inspire its members to make a difference in their communities. Foresters Equity Services Inc. and Foresters Securities (Canada) Inc. are wholly owned subsidiaries of Foresters that offer investment products in the United States and Canada respectively. * An "A" (Excellent) rating is assigned to companies that have a strong ability to meet their ongoing obligations to policyholders and have, on balance, excellent balance sheet strength, operating performance and business profile when compared to the standards established by A.M. Best Company. In assigning Foresters rating, A.M. Best stated that Foresters rating outlook is "stable", which means it is unlikely to change in the near future, assuming Foresters financial strength is maintained and operations grow. A.M. Best assigns ratings from A++ to F, A++ being superior ratings and A and A- being excellent ratings.
About CSC
Founded in 1959, Computer Sciences Corporation is a leading global information technology (IT) services company. CSC's mission is to provide customers in industry and government with solutions crafted to meet their specific challenges and enable them to profit from the advanced use of technology.
With approximately 78,000 employees, CSC provides innovative solutions for customers around the world by applying leading technologies and CSC's own advanced capabilities. These include systems design and integration; IT and business process outsourcing; applications software development; Web and application hosting; and management consulting. Headquartered in El Segundo, Calif., CSC reported revenue of $14.6 billion for the 12 months ended June 30, 2006. For more information, visit the company's Web site at http://www.csc.com/.
